PQCVisualizer

Post-QuantumEducationCryptography

Problem

Post-quantum cryptography tradeoffs are hard to reason about without concrete comparisons of signature sizes and infrastructure cost.

Approach

Built an interactive educational platform comparing Dilithium, Falcon, SPHINCS+, and classical algorithms with visual infra tradeoffs.

Outcome

Referenced by MIT DCI (in collaboration with JPMorgan Kinexys) and listed as a recommended resource by the University of Messina Quantum Computing and Information Systems Lab.

BLS Lab

CryptographyEducationToolkit

Problem

Applied cryptography concepts like BLS signatures and secret sharing are often inaccessible without dense academic material.

Approach

Shipped a modern toolkit of interactive tools: signature aggregation, hashing playgrounds, function selectors, and Shamir’s Secret Sharing, for developers and students.

Outcome

A public cryptography lab used for education and hands-on exploration of protocols that power modern blockchain systems.
